Welcome home to this classic 4 bedroom, 2.5 bathroom colonial farmhouse located in the heart of the Pine Bush School district. Built in 1783 stronger than most new homes are built today, you'll find quality craftsmanship throughout the home in it's woodwork and finer details - especially in its door frames, windows frames, main stairs railing and balusters. Gleaming hardwood floors are found mostly throughout this residence. The large open kitchen and dining room with tin ceiling has plenty of space for the whole family. The large parlor room with exposed beams could also be used as a formal dining room. The spacious living room with exposed beams and large windows letting plenty of natural light in. Laundry room on main floor as well as a half bathroom off of the kitchen. Four nicely sized bedrooms including the huge primary bedroom which features hardwood floors, an en-suite bathroom and two closets including a walk-in closet. Second full bathroom located on the second floor. Bedrooms three and four are nice sized with new carpeting. Enjoy a beautiful day on the large front porch, or perhaps on the rear porch overlooking your nice, level back yard. Plenty of parking on the driveway. Close to the Highway Route 17 (future I-86), and close to many State Parks, State Forests and hiking trails of this beautiful region near the foothills of the Catskills.
